Transaction 3515843babad0eb3c0c89a16bf5713b709830ff3098a8a83a89771884f000886
1 Input
1 Output
-
3515843babad0eb3c0c89a16bf5713b709830ff3098a8a83a89771884f000886:0
- value
- 109409
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1090695a8f502f59a0d08ac82591c44c8aa3352b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12WaoxcbpsaRGiG3UbA8ReAUkBzZGgTjML